Saji Cherian Affirms Support for G. Sudhakaran Amid Misunderstanding

Fisheries Minister Saji Cherian has publicly stated that he did not criticize veteran CPI(M) leader G. Sudhakaran, referring to him as "my leader." In a clarification made on Sunday, Cherian emphasized that there is no misunderstanding between him and Sudhakaran and urged the media not to create any misconceptions. He expressed confidence in Sudhakaran's leadership within the party, asserting that Sudhakaran will continue to lead from the front and participate in all party activities. Cherian also mentioned that he does not give advice and affirmed that what Sudhakaran has said is correct.
